Randomized double-blind placebo-controlled trial of hydrogen inhalation for Parkinson’s disease: a pilot study

Yoritaka A et al. · Neurol Sci. 2021;42(11):4767–4770.

Methods at a glance

Population or model

Japanese adults with Parkinson’s disease receiving levodopa

Sample

20 enrolled; 15 included in the per-protocol analysis: H₂ n=7 and placebo n=8

Duration

1 hour twice daily for 16 weeks

Intervention

Mixed air containing H₂ at 2,000 mL/min for 1 hour twice daily

Hydrogen form

H₂ diluted in air — H₂ was the active added gas, not Brown’s gas.

H₂ specification

6.5 ± 0.1% H₂ in the 2 L/min source mixture.

H₂ flow

130 mL/min H₂, calculated as 2,000 mL/min source-gas flow × 6.5% H₂.

O₂ delivered with H₂

No supplemental O₂ was reported. Because the balance composition of the mixed air is not quantified, O₂ flow cannot be calculated.

Comparator

Placebo air at 2,000 mL/min from an indistinguishable modified machine

Outcomes and reported result

Outcomes measured

MDS-UPDRS, PDQ-39, oxidative-stress measures, adherence and adverse events

Reported result

No significant between-group difference was found in total MDS-UPDRS or its parts at week 16. No adverse events were reported.

Design and reporting cautions

Very small pilot; five of 20 participants were excluded for insufficient inhalation time, leaving an unbalanced per-protocol sample. Several authors disclosed pharmaceutical relationships and departmental commercial endowments.

Applies directly to

Adults with Parkinson’s disease receiving levodopa under the reported home-inhalation protocol.
